How To Fix /CFG/TASKLIST111 - ZQR qualifier wrongly setup, import from Q system maybe still pending


/CFG/TASKLIST111 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: /CFG/TASKLIST -

  • Message number: 111

  • Message text: ZQR qualifier wrongly setup, import from Q system maybe still pending

    The SAP error message /CFG/TASKLIST111 ZQR qualifier wrongly setup, import from Q system maybe still pending typically indicates an issue with the configuration of a task list qualifier in the SAP system. This error often arises in the context of transport management, particularly when dealing with the import of transport requests from a Quality (Q) system to a Production (P) system.
    
    Cause: Incorrect Configuration: The ZQR qualifier may not be set up correctly in the system. This could be due to a misconfiguration in the transport management settings. Pending Imports: There may be pending transport requests that have not been imported from the Quality system, which can lead to inconsistencies in the configuration. Transport Directory Issues: Problems with the transport directory or transport logs can also cause this error. Authorization Issues: Lack of proper authorizations for the user trying to perform the import can lead to this error.
